Transaction 12580e424c80fa012efc04fd45147ef93fcebc56e870c31524c88c46fca97a59
1 Input
2 Outputs
- 12580e424c80fa012efc04fd45147ef93fcebc56e870c31524c88c46fca97a59:0
- 12580e424c80fa012efc04fd45147ef93fcebc56e870c31524c88c46fca97a59:1
value 24439230
address 19jHh9CXKdZnTVA4nmb7fB6jXT55d3JkRy
value 4996900
address 3KEAPWpQUjNrioJ3FV6Croj7oo4AT3cjN2